#6f9988 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6f9988 is composed of 43.5% red, 60%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.1%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 155.7 degrees, a saturation of 17.1% and a lightness of 51.8%. #6f9988 color hex could be obtained by blending #deffff with #003311.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

#6f9988 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6f9988 has RGB values of R:111, G:153,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0, Y:0.11,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 7313800.
